CNY holiday
02.19.07 (9:26 pm)   [edit]

CNY holiday today. Last night I chat with my brother Mitch and we recalled how we used to celebrate CNY when we were kids. He was such a big fan of the lion dance. Every year dad would buy him the Lion dance competition VCR tape and he would watch and imitate. Then when it came to performing, this was where I had to take part. My parents, after nagging and persuading from Mitch, bought him the lion head and mom had to sew the body and tail for him. So, he would go from house to house in our neighborhood or whichever house we visited to show off his skills. Man, I had to be the other half of the body and I was too embarassed to move and jump since I thought I wasn't a kid anymore (which I still was actually)! Ignoring all the fools we made out of ourselves, we actually collected lots of red packets! *_*
